Designing for Conversion
Designing for Conversion
Blog Article
As a web designer, your goal isn't just to create visually appealing websites; it's to build experiences that drive conversions. To achieve this, you need to understand the psychology behind user behavior and apply design strategies that lead visitors toward taking desired actions.
- Prioritize on clarity and simplicity in your website's navigation. Make it straightforward for users to find what they're looking for.
- Utilize strong call-to-actions (CTAs) that are concise and compelling.
- Optimize your website's loading speed to decrease bounce rates. A slow site can discourage visitors.
By incorporating these guidelines, you can create a high-converting website that attains its goals. Remember, the key is to place the user experience at the center.

Building Websites that Adapt to Any Display
In today's digital landscape, where users access content across a vast spectrum of devices, responsive design has become an essential element for website performance. Responsive design is a strategy that guarantees websites display flawlessly on all screen resolutions, from small mobile phones to extensive desktops. By leveraging dynamic layouts and media requests, developers can create websites that seamlessly adjust to suit the specific requirements of each device.
- Merits of responsive design include enhanced user experience, increased engagement, and enhanced website performance.
- By embracing responsive design principles, websites can cater to a wider audience, leading to expanded awareness and prosperity.

Unlocking Accessibility: Designing Inclusive Websites for Everyone
Building inclusive websites is not just a moral imperative, but also a strategic advantage. By considering the needs of all users, including those with disabilities, we can create captivating experiences that reach a wider audience. A truly vibrant web experience starts with understanding the principles of accessibility and implementing strategic design solutions. This means providing clear navigation, alternative text for images, and keyboard-accessible content, among other crucial considerations. By embracing these guidelines, we can ensure that everyone, regardless of their abilities, can access and engage with the wealth of information and opportunities available online.
Some key aspects to consider include:
- Delivering clear and concise language
- Ensuring proper color contrast for readability
- Using descriptive link text
- Creating keyboard-navigable interfaces
By committing in accessibility, we create a more equitable web for all. It's a win-win situation that benefits both users and website owners.
